roulade ( synonym found)

Definition of roulade:

(n) : a slice of meat that is rolled up, stuffed, and cooked; an elaborate embellishment of several notes sung to one syllable

Definition of roulade:

(n) : a slice of meat that is rolled up, stuffed, and cooked; an elaborate embellishment of several notes sung to one syllable

Back to Top